Pitch is determined by the frequency of sound waves. Higher frequencies create higher pitches and lower frequencies create lower pitches. This relationship allows us to distinguish between high and low notes in music and other sounds.
Pitch refers to how high or low a sound is, determined by the frequency of the sound waves. Volume, on the other hand, refers to how loud or soft a sound is, determined by the amplitude of the sound waves.

The pitch is related to how fast the sound wave vibrations are, while the amplitude is related to the intensity or strength of the sound wave.
Loudness refers to the intensity or volume of a sound, while pitch refers to the frequency of the sound waves. A loud sound has higher amplitude and is perceived as stronger, whereas pitch is determined by the frequency of sound waves and how high or low they are. In summary, loudness is about the strength of a sound, while pitch is about its frequency.
